Greenville Spartanburg International Airport Ground Transportation Map (2025-2024)
The Greenville Spartanburg International Airport Ground Transportation Map helps you locate all transport options available outside the main terminal at Greenville Spartanburg Airport (IATA: GSP).
Because the airport operates from a single terminal building, ground transport services are conveniently arranged just steps from the arrivals hall.
Follow curbside signs marked “Ground Transportation,” “Taxis,” and “Ride Services” on Level 1 to reach your chosen option quickly. The setup keeps walking distances short and wayfinding simple for every traveler.

In mid-June 2025, Greenville-Spartanburg International Airport (GSP) completed a major terminal parkway expansion, adding two additional lanes and designated zones for drop-offs, ride-sharing, and shuttle services.
These improvements accommodate increased traffic and support the airport’s growth.

Are shuttles running at GSP airport?
Shuttle service at Greenville-Spartanburg (GSP) Airport is operating. Airport shuttles run between the terminal and parking areas to assist passengers with transfers. Shuttle frequency may vary depending on the time of day and parking lot demand.
Can I get an Uber from GSP airport?
Uber service is available at Greenville-Spartanburg (GSP) Airport, and passengers can request a ride using the Uber app upon arrival. The designated pickup location is on the center island of the front pickup/drop-off lanes outside the terminal. Scheduled and on-demand rides are possible, but Uber does not allow scheduled pickups from most airports; simply request when you are ready to leave.
How to get to ground transportation at GSP?
Ground transportation at Greenville-Spartanburg (GSP) Airport is located just outside the terminal on the lower level. Passengers should exit the baggage claim area and follow signs for “Ground Transportation” to reach taxis, rideshares, and shuttles. The pickup zones are clearly marked on the center island in front of the terminal.
Does Greenville Spartanburg International Airport have public transportation?
Greenville-Spartanburg International Airport does not have direct public bus or train services. Travelers may use taxis, hotel shuttles, private shuttles, rideshare apps, or arrange connections to nearby transit options. The local Greenlink bus is accessible from downtown Greenville, but requires a taxi or rideshare from the airport to a bus stop.
